Humans are a product of evolutionary processes from "summary" of The Language of God by Francis Collins

The evidence supporting the theory of evolution is overwhelming. By examining the fossil record, scientists have been able to trace the gradual changes in species over millions of years. Genetic studies have revealed striking similarities in the DNA of different species, providing further proof of a common ancestry. The process of natural selection, where traits that are beneficial for survival are passed down to future generations, has been observed in action. It is clear that humans are not exempt from the forces of evolution. Our own DNA bears the marks of our evolutionary history, showing similarities with other primates such as chimpanzees.
